About the role

The Assistant Property Manager oversees all operations of a commercial real estate portfolio. The role is responsible for achieving superior operational results and financial performance, serving as point person for the portfolio of commercial properties, providing a best-in-class level of service to the tenants in the portfolio, and supervising third party vendors.

Responsibilities

  • Professionally represent HHC while adhering to the terms and conditions of the management agreement.
  • Ensure compliance with Property Management Policies and Procedures, codes, regulations, and governmental agency directives.
  • Provide management and leadership to property staff, including hiring and performance management.
  • Develop comprehensive annual inspection process for properties; complete weekly, monthly, quarterly, annual inspections as required for a specific assets and HHC’s best practices.
  • Develop operating and capital budgets, track variances, oversee the completion of CAM reconciliations, and ensure smooth recovery process.
  • Bid, negotiate, and manage conformity with vendor contracts in accordance with TW and the client’s procurement contract requirements.
  • Maintain interface with third-party owners and accounting team to ensure total contract compliance, including preparation of accurate and timely reporting.
  • Cook up and oversee all tenant and building construction work to ensure timely and accurate completion of all construction work at property on behalf of client.
  • Participate in leasing and client team meetings and ensure effective communication between leasing and property management team members in order to achieve goals and objectives.
  • Provide and foster positive relationships with tenants, external clients, and internal clients.
  • Represent and communicate clearly and accurately, in person, over the phone, and in writing the authority of the property manager based on legal agreements in effect and HHH policies.
  • Cook up and oversee training and development activities for team members.
  • Foster relationships with BOMA/local CRE members to maintain awareness of competitor activity and/new business development opportunities.
  • Add additional duties or projects as assigned by Senior Leadership.

About Howard Hughes Communities

Howard Hughes Communities develops, owns, and operates the nation’s premier large-scale master planned communities and mixed-use developments. Our award-winning portfolio includes The Woodlands®, Bridgeland®, and The Woodlands Hills® in Greater Houston; Summerlin® in Las Vegas; Teravalis™ in Greater Phoenix; Ward Village® in Honolulu; and Merriweather District® in Columbia, Maryland.
